Aarhus: Where History and Creativity Converge
Situated on the Jutland peninsula, Aarhus is Denmark's second-largest city, offering a unique blend of historical significance and contemporary creativity. Dive into the Viking Age at the Moesgaard Museum, then wander through the cobbled streets of the Old Town for a journey back in time. Aarhus is also a cultural hub, housing the ARoS Aarhus Art Museum, a stunning architectural marvel with a diverse collection of contemporary art. With its lively atmosphere, innovative culinary scene, and a backdrop of coastal beauty, Aarhus invites travelers to explore the intersection of tradition and modernity in the heart of Denmark.

Chiang Rai White Temple
Chiang Rai White Temple is a special architectural work of art with walls and buildings built entirely in white. This temple blends the cultures of contemporary Buddhism and Hinduism and was created by Thai national artist Chalermchai Kositpipat.
Coming here, you will be overwhelmed by the temple architecture decorated with intricate sculptures and paintings about spirituality and history.
Explore Famous Geisha and Maiko Culture
Gion Kyoto Old Town is an attractive destination for tourists, especially those who want to enjoy Geisha and Maiko culture. In the evening, when walking on the streets of Gion old town, you will have the opportunity to encounter a geiko or maiko on the way to or from meetings at ochayas. You can also enjoy dinner in person at an ochaya, where talented maikos and geikos tend to guests with gentle conversation, serve drinks, lead drinking games, and perform traditional dances.

Stroll around the DUMBO neighborhood
Brooklyn has some interesting neighborhoods, and one that has a large fan base is the DUMBO neighborhood – Down Under Manhattan Bridge Overpass. DUMBO's trendy cobblestone streets and warehouse buildings have been transformed into independent bookstores, art galleries, upscale restaurants and hip coffee shops. Tourists often explore this place after walking across the Brooklyn Bridge, stopping to admire the beautiful view of Manhattan at Brooklyn Bridge Park.
